Transaction 52985ac644a282da4617970aa64a0ef4d581e904e22e85869e935dc6ba250e71
1 Input
1 Output
-
52985ac644a282da4617970aa64a0ef4d581e904e22e85869e935dc6ba250e71:0
- value
- 2078969
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e0450cf631bdcc5883cad3a44dc3c344842e0d7 OP_EQUAL
- address
- 35tLBE36bUc4sFrzpXdJZa4rFfmmqYXRqz